Previous NextRecently Updated121 Bedroom Flat for Sale£399,000Escuan Lodge, Aberdeen Park, Highbury, London, N5Property TypeFlatBedrooms× 1Bathrooms× 1Receptions× 1TenureShare of freehold
Previous NextRecently Updated121 Bedroom Flat for Sale£399,000Escuan Lodge, Aberdeen Park, Highbury, London, N5Property TypeFlatBedrooms× 1Bathrooms× 1Receptions× 1TenureShare of freehold